Game of the Week

Auburn at LSU — A top 5 pre-season pick versus a perennial SEC West contender.

Blow-out of the Week

Mississippi State at West Virginia — WVU is probably overrated, but they can’t be nearly overrated enough to make this a game.

Rivalry Special

Tennessee at Alabama — No love lost here. Should be a hell of a ball game, too.

Morbid Curiosity

Vandy at South Carolina — Two teams that look stellar half the time and like high school players the other half. You just never know what you’re going to get.

The Rest of ‘Em

Arkansas at Ole Miss — Ole Miss is going to give the Hogs a better game than anyone expects, and that will not be difficult.

Florida at Kentucky — Good team with a mediocre QB. Mediocre team with a good QB. If they could combine it’d probably be good enough for another MNC.

Georgia is off this week.
